The Validity Period of IELTS Scores

One of the most crucial elements of taking the IELTS is comprehending the credibility of the ratings. The IELTS Test Report Form (TRF) is usually valid for 2 years from the date of the test. This two-year timeframe is important for numerous reasons, and it is essential for test-takers to be conscious of it when planning their future ventures.

Below is a summary of the credibility period:

Test ComponentValidity
IELTS Test Report Form (TRF)2 years from the test date

Why is the Validity Duration Two Years?

The two-year credibility duration is designed to ensure that ball games reflect the test-taker's current capabilities. Language proficiency can vary gradually, and a rating from a number of years prior might not properly represent an individual's present abilities. Therefore, institutions and companies generally need current scores for applications to guarantee that candidates can meet the interaction demands of their particular fields.

Secret Components of the IELTS Test

The IELTS exam includes four primary elements, each adding to the overall band score:

ComponentPeriodDescription
Listening30 minutesFour sections, each with 10 concerns. website -takers listen to conversations and monologues.
Reading60 minutes3 sections, with texts differing in length and design. The Academic and General Training Reading tests vary in content.
Writing60 minutes2 tasks: one includes explaining a graph/chart (Academic) or writing a letter (General Training), and the other requires an essay.
Speaking11-14 minutesAn in person interview divided into three parts: intro, a brief speech on a subject, and a conversation.
